Andrew Abraham is a founding partner at the firm of Baker & Abraham, P.C. Attorney Abraham concentrates his practice on the representation of seriously injured clients with a particular emphasis on brain damage. As you can see from the list of representative cases and results, Attorney Abraham has obtained numerous recoveries in excess of one million dollars, plus many six figure settlements and/or judgments. As a result of his accomplishments, Attorney Abraham was named one of the five "Up-and-Coming Lawyers" in Massachusetts Lawyers Weekly in 1999. In their May, 2005 issue, Boston Magazine and SuperLawyers Magazine named attorney Abraham one of their Rising Stars.
Attorney Abraham graduated from Deerfield Academy (1988), then attended Bates College (B.A. 1992). Attorney Abraham graduated cum laude from Suffolk University Law School in 1995 and was admitted to the bar in December, 1995. After graduation, Attorney Abraham practiced at Rainer & Rainer where he became the Senior Trial Counsel and then worked for the Sheff Law Offices. All of Attorney Abraham's practice has been in personal injury with extensive experience in the representation of brain injured clients.
Attorney Abraham is active in local and national trial lawyer's bar associations. Attorney Abraham has been the chair of the Massachusetts Academy of Trial Attorney's (MATA) Education Committee for the last three years and a Board of Governor for six years. Attorney Abraham chaired the “Masters on Damages” educational seminar that was one of the most well attended seminars by plaintiff and defense lawyers in recent history. Before Chairing the Education Committee, Attorney Abraham served as Chair of the Bench/Bar Committee and also Chair of the New Lawyers Committee. Attorney Abraham is also a member of the Association of Trial Lawyers of America (ATLA).
